Web 2.0 has led to an explosion of social media choices for employees, and a world
of worry for compliance and ethics professionals.

  • What do you do about employee use of these sites during the workday?
  • What about after work?
  • Who monitors what is being said about the company?

And what about your organization’s own use, since even professional associations like the
HCCA and SCCE have presences on these sites?

In this web conference we’ll share the results of the SCCE’s and HCCA’s joint survey of compliance practices.

We will then discuss the issue with in-house practitioners with direct experience in managing this
still-evolving issue.
